While it may seem like a resolution from the past, the 128x96 format actively serves several modern niches:

Windows and macOS store cached thumbnail previews in hidden database folders. These are often saved as small JPEGs, sometimes exactly 128x96. Forensic analysts use specialized viewers to extract these caches without altering timestamps.
